Similarly, the tool works with Windows 7 or higher, and Mac OS X 10.9 or later. It only supports transfer for compatible smartphones running at least Android 4.3 or iOS 4.2.1 versions.

The Smart Switch tool is not fully compatible with all devices. While Smart Switch works well most of the time, you may occasionally have some problems with it.
